Butterworths products are used every day in legal practices throughout the UK Butterworths was established in 1818 and has grown to become the leading provider of legal and tax information for practitioners in the UK. Many of our books and services are used and relied upon every day by solicitors and barristers and other legal professionals - whether working in large city firms, sets of chambers, high street practices or in local authorities. Many of our products are relied upon and cited in court. |
|
Butterworths products are known for their accuracy, authority, and reliability. As well as the major encyclopaedias for which we are famous (like Halsbury's Laws and the Encyclopaedia of Forms and Precedents), we also offer a comprehensive range of looseleaf products and books in every area of practice. In recent years we have followed the move in the legal market towards electronic delivery by offering an increasing number of information sources in CD-ROM form and, recently, we have introduced several online services which are remarkably quick, effective, reliable and easy to use.
